Websites
Activity
Learn
Support Us
Sign up for Free
Sign In
Neocities.org
Welcome to my home page!
imsohappy.neocities.org
4,331
views
0
followers
1
update
0
tips
Share
imsohappy
updated
Welcome to my home page!
7 years ago
Welcome to my home page!
Website Stats
Last updated
7 years ago
Created
Sep 19, 2017
Site Traffic Stats
Tags
nature
videogames
outdoor